In U.S. territories and federal district
[edit]The United States Census Bureau also divides the U.S. territories and the District of Columbia into county-equivalents:
- American Samoa's districts and atolls
- Guam is counted as a single county-equivalent
- Northern Mariana Islands municipalities
- Puerto Rico municipalities
- Each main island of the U.S. Virgin Islands
- Each island of the United States Minor Outlying Islands
- Washington, D.C. is counted as a single county-equivalent
